Xu Chuchu thought about it and took off the dragon egg on her back. She uncovered the cloth and showed it to the fox fairy: "This is the dragon egg that the queen entrusted to us before she died. It must be her offspring."

"Oh oh—" the fox fairy cried out strangely and quickly wrapped the cloth again, "This dragon egg is extremely precious! You must not open it carelessly!"

"This is the queen's offspring, it must be hatched as soon as possible!"

After he said that, he snatched the egg back and blew a blast of fox fire at it!

"What are you doing!" Xu Chuchu forcibly blocked the flames and snatched the egg back.

The fox fairy was secretly surprised at how fast Xu Chuchu's cultivation had grown, and explained, "If you just leave it like this for another hundred years, it won't hatch!"

"We know we have to soak it in warm water." Xu Chuchu argued.

"Soaking dragon eggs in warm water? Who are you looking down on?" The fox fairy said as if she had just heard the biggest joke. "Dragons are the most noble and powerful creatures. Even our fox fire can't do anything to them, not to mention that this egg has strong protection."

He asked Xu Chuchu to put the dragon egg on the ground and spit fox fire on it. The flame wrapped around the egg. Sure enough, the eggshell was not damaged at all. Instead, it began to shake slightly, not because of the pain of being burned, but more like joy.

"See?" the fox fairy said, "It has to be burned several times like this every day."

"The fox fairy seems to know a lot about the dragon clan, but has it ever dealt with the dragon clan in the past?" Xiao Yu suddenly interrupted.

The fox fairy tugged at his mustache again: "...It's not really a deal, but I did witness the internal strife of the dragon clan a thousand years ago."

"Civil unrest?"

"You should already know that even if ordinary people have seen dragons, they will quickly forget them, right?" The fox fairy said, "This is a dragon spell. Only if a high-level dragon recognizes you can you have the right to remember them. Otherwise, you will forget them in the blink of an eye."

So that's how it is. Xu Chuchu and Xiao Yu can remember dragons, probably with the permission of the Red Dragon Queen.

"What is a high-level dragon? A Dragon King?" Xu Chuchu asked.

"The Dragon King or his mate," the fox fairy said. "During the last civil war among the dragon clan, the green dragon suffered heavy casualties. He requested the fox clan's help, asking us to guide the deceased's soul to the other world. After the civil war ended, because they didn't want the news of the other world and the dragon clan to spread, they discussed with me and erased my clan's memory of dragons, but kept mine."

"What happened during the last civil unrest?" Xiao Yu was concerned about this question.

"It's because the Black Dragon and the other dragons don't get along." The fox fairy unconsciously lowered her voice as she spoke, fearing someone might overhear. "The Black Dragon believes the Red Dragon is too kind to all living things and shouldn't let so many lives—especially humans—run wild and wanton on this land."

"The black dragons believe that humans have disrupted the balance of nature by building houses and cities, ruthlessly hunting animals with ferocious weapons, and transforming natural land into fields for growing food. They say that sooner or later, the earth will be destroyed by humans, and they ask the Red Dragon Queen to stop protecting humans."

Xu Chuchu's heart sank when she heard this.

To a certain extent, Heilong is right. In the long process of progress, humans have caused a lot of irreversible damage to nature.

Although some efforts are being made to make up for it, the modern environment is completely different from what it was before.

The fox fairy continued, "But the Red Dragon clan believes that all creatures born of nature are equal and must follow the changes of nature. She grants plants the ability to grow and also gives humans hope for a new life. The other three clans also recognize the Red Dragon."

"So the black dragon was enraged. He believed he was right and that the other races were ostracizing him. They attacked the most vulnerable green dragons and provoked a war."

"...I don't know exactly how this battle was fought. The struggle of the dragon clan is not something a mere fox demon like me can influence."

"The end result was that the Black Dragon clan was imprisoned by several other clans, and the land he guarded was also guarded by several other clans in turn."

"But you said you saw swarms of black dragons. That means they've made a comeback. They might be the ones persecuting the Red Dragon Queen."

So that's how it was. Xu Chuchu finally understood what was going on.

"It's no accident that you're involved in this matter. Nothing about dragons happens by chance," the fox fairy said suddenly, "be prepared for the risk."

Xu Chuchu touched the petal-like jade in her arms. It was given to her by Sect Leader Feng, who asked her to find the remaining two people to make up the five people.

But where are the remaining two people? These days, she took it out from time to time to see if that person was around, but the jade did not respond.

Now it is not lit, which means that the fox fairy in front of him is not one of them. I don’t know whether it is fortunate or unfortunate.

The fox fairy suddenly sniffed. "Hey, are you hiding flowers and plants on your body to cover up the smell and prevent the black dragon from finding you? Well, that's a good idea, but the flowers and plants you pick will wither and lose their scent in half a day at most."

He picked a few foxtail flowers from the ground, flicked them with his fingers, and handed them to them.

"Okay, this is the foxtail flower that never fades. As long as you hide it on your body, the black dragon will never be able to find you by scent."

Xu Chuchu had never seen a fox fairy offer help before, so she was "flattered". After making sure that the fox fairy had no other conspiracy, she carefully accepted it.

From this point of view, although the fox fairy is not a good fox, it is still acceptable.

He didn't force them to take the Cangyun Sword, told them honestly about the dragon clan, and helped them avoid the black dragon's pursuit. It seemed...

"What are you still doing here? I've already helped you so much," the fox fairy said. "You're dangerous. Leave now and don't bring trouble to Fox Mountain!"

Sure enough, I was overthinking it.

After completing the blood oath and obtaining some information, Xu Chuchu put away the dragon egg and, at the constant urging of the fox fairy, went down the mountain with Xiao Yu.

"The most urgent task now is to hatch the dragon egg and find the other two people instructed by the Red Dragon Queen." On the way, Xu Chuchu gently stroked the dragon egg while thinking, "But where should I go to find them in such a vast sea of ​​people?"

"Actually, I've been thinking about this the whole time," Xiao Yu continued. "Although the Red Dragon Queen's style of operation is mysterious, she hasn't yet come up with a completely unfounded puzzle. Every move she makes is either based on a clue or planned in advance."

"So I guess the remaining two people are either people close to you, or people she arranged to meet you."

Xu Chuchu thought about it and felt that it made sense: "So what I should do now is to meet with everyone I know and check them one by one?"

This is not a difficult matter, because most of the people who are familiar with Xu Chuchu are in Beijing.
